Craving a juicy flavorful steak but not in the mood to fire up the grill? No problem! This stovetop skirt steak is sure to satisfy and is very versatile. I like to serve it alongside roasted sweet potatoes, peppers and onions, or over a bed of lettuce.
Ingredients:
- 1 gallon ziplock bag
- 2 lbs skirt steak
- ¾ cup avocado oil
- 3 tsp salt
- 1 Tbsp garlic powders
- 1.5 Tbsp dried oregano
- 1 Tbsp ghee
- 1 Tbsp avocado oil
Directions:
- In ziplock bag, combine avocado oil, salt, garlic powder, and oregano
- Zip with the air removed and squeeze the bottom of the bag, combining the ingredients together
- Once mixed, add the skirt steak to the bag, seal and mix ensuring it is evenly coated in the marinade. Let marinate overnight.
- When ready to cook, heat your grill pan over medium heat
- Add 1 Tbsp avocado oil and 1 Tbsp ghee to the pan
- Cook steak about 4 minutes per side, or until nicely charred
- Let rest about 7 minutes on cutting board before cutting
